All the content of TDM is already available under a permissive license, so you should be able to use them if you add credits and don't use the game/map commercially (which I think you won't):

 

All maps, textures, models, def files, audio assets, and all other

non-software components of The Dark Mod are licensed under the

Creative Commons Attribution-Noncommercial-Share Alike 3.0 Unported license,

as specified at http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-nc-sa/3.0/legalcode

and described at http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-nc-sa/3.0/

 

As an exception to the above, derivative works of assets taken from DOOM 3

or from the DOOM 3 Software Development Kit are licensed under the DOOM 3

Software Development Kit Limited Use License Agreement, reproduced below.
